Opinion

PER CURIAM.

Petition for writ of habeas corpus by Harvey Tompson, filed June 28, 1923, alleging illegal restraint by E. C. London, sheriff of Carter county. Motion by petitioner to dismiss said cause allowed, and petition dismissed.
